diff options
Diffstat (limited to 'firmware/export')
-rw-r--r-- | firmware/export/config/iriverh100.h | 1 | ||||
-rw-r--r-- | firmware/export/config/iriverh120.h | 1 | ||||
-rw-r--r-- | firmware/export/config/iriverh300.h | 1 | ||||
-rw-r--r-- | firmware/export/system.h | 4 |
4 files changed, 5 insertions, 2 deletions
diff --git a/firmware/export/config/iriverh100.h b/firmware/export/config/iriverh100.h index bbfab01ba5..b7f1ca4b30 100644 --- a/firmware/export/config/iriverh100.h +++ b/firmware/export/config/iriverh100.h | |||
@@ -172,6 +172,7 @@ | |||
172 | #define BOOTFILE "rockbox." BOOTFILE_EXT | 172 | #define BOOTFILE "rockbox." BOOTFILE_EXT |
173 | #define BOOTDIR "/.rockbox" | 173 | #define BOOTDIR "/.rockbox" |
174 | 174 | ||
175 | #define FLASH_BASE 0x00000000 | ||
175 | #define BOOTLOADER_ENTRYPOINT 0x001F0000 | 176 | #define BOOTLOADER_ENTRYPOINT 0x001F0000 |
176 | #define FLASH_RAMIMAGE_ENTRY 0x00001000 | 177 | #define FLASH_RAMIMAGE_ENTRY 0x00001000 |
177 | #define FLASH_ROMIMAGE_ENTRY 0x00100000 | 178 | #define FLASH_ROMIMAGE_ENTRY 0x00100000 |
diff --git a/firmware/export/config/iriverh120.h b/firmware/export/config/iriverh120.h index 77ee1382be..4b658bcf49 100644 --- a/firmware/export/config/iriverh120.h +++ b/firmware/export/config/iriverh120.h | |||
@@ -178,6 +178,7 @@ | |||
178 | #define BOOTFILE "rockbox." BOOTFILE_EXT | 178 | #define BOOTFILE "rockbox." BOOTFILE_EXT |
179 | #define BOOTDIR "/.rockbox" | 179 | #define BOOTDIR "/.rockbox" |
180 | 180 | ||
181 | #define FLASH_BASE 0x00000000 | ||
181 | #define BOOTLOADER_ENTRYPOINT 0x001F0000 | 182 | #define BOOTLOADER_ENTRYPOINT 0x001F0000 |
182 | #define FLASH_RAMIMAGE_ENTRY 0x00001000 | 183 | #define FLASH_RAMIMAGE_ENTRY 0x00001000 |
183 | #define FLASH_ROMIMAGE_ENTRY 0x00100000 | 184 | #define FLASH_ROMIMAGE_ENTRY 0x00100000 |
diff --git a/firmware/export/config/iriverh300.h b/firmware/export/config/iriverh300.h index f901f160c6..e5805dd8f4 100644 --- a/firmware/export/config/iriverh300.h +++ b/firmware/export/config/iriverh300.h | |||
@@ -187,6 +187,7 @@ | |||
187 | #define BOOTFILE "rockbox." BOOTFILE_EXT | 187 | #define BOOTFILE "rockbox." BOOTFILE_EXT |
188 | #define BOOTDIR "/.rockbox" | 188 | #define BOOTDIR "/.rockbox" |
189 | 189 | ||
190 | #define FLASH_BASE 0x00000000 | ||
190 | #define BOOTLOADER_ENTRYPOINT 0x003F0000 | 191 | #define BOOTLOADER_ENTRYPOINT 0x003F0000 |
191 | #define FLASH_RAMIMAGE_ENTRY 0x00001000 | 192 | #define FLASH_RAMIMAGE_ENTRY 0x00001000 |
192 | #define FLASH_ROMIMAGE_ENTRY 0x00200000 | 193 | #define FLASH_ROMIMAGE_ENTRY 0x00200000 |
diff --git a/firmware/export/system.h b/firmware/export/system.h index 1885acfffd..68d7958870 100644 --- a/firmware/export/system.h +++ b/firmware/export/system.h | |||
@@ -36,8 +36,8 @@ extern void system_init(void); | |||
36 | extern long cpu_frequency; | 36 | extern long cpu_frequency; |
37 | 37 | ||
38 | struct flash_header { | 38 | struct flash_header { |
39 | unsigned long magic; | 39 | uint32_t magic; |
40 | unsigned long length; | 40 | uint32_t length; |
41 | char version[32]; | 41 | char version[32]; |
42 | }; | 42 | }; |
43 | 43 | ||